Čo je kolaboratívne filtrovanie
Kolaboratívne filtrovanie je kľúčovým odporúčacím systémom v rámci filtrovania informácií, ktorý sa špecializuje najmä na personalizované návrhy obsahu. Funguje na princípe využívania kolektívnych preferencií a správania skupín používateľov na prispôsobenie odporúčaní jednotlivcom v rámci tejto skupiny.
Dva spôsoby kolaboratívneho filtrovania
Na základe používateľa: Táto metóda navrhuje používateľom položky na základe preferencií ostatných používateľov s podobným vkusom. Identifikácia používateľov, ktorí zdieľajú porovnateľné preferencie alebo vzorce správania, odporúča položky, ktoré sú obľúbené podobne zmýšľajúcimi jednotlivcami, pričom sa predpokladá, že ich budúce preferencie sa budú zhodovať.
Na základe položky: Tento prístup sa na rozdiel od stratégií zameraných na používateľa zameriava na podobnosť položiek. Navrhuje položky podobné tým, ktoré sa používateľovi predtým páčili a o ktoré sa zaujímal, pričom vychádza z predpokladu, že používateľov, ktorí inklinujú k jednej položke, pravdepodobne zaujmú podobné ponuky.
Ako funguje a ako sa používa
Systémy kolaboratívneho filtrovania sa pri generovaní presných odporúčaní spoliehajú najmä na významné údaje používateľov, ako sú hodnotenia, lajky alebo interakcie. Tieto systémy, ktoré sú široko integrované v rôznych oblastiach, ako sú e-commerce platformy (napr. funkcia “Zákazníci, ktorí si kúpili tento tovar, si ho tiež kúpili” na Amazone), streamovacie služby (ako je odporúčací systém Netflixu) a platformy sociálnych sietí (napr. návrhy priateľov na Facebooku), optimalizujú používateľský zážitok prostredníctvom návrhov šitých na mieru.
Výhody a nevýhody
Kolaboratívne filtrovanie má tú výhodu, že poskytuje personalizované odporúčania bez explicitnej znalosti položky alebo používateľa. Potýka sa však s problémami, ako je problém “studeného štartu”, ktorý bráni odporúčaniam pre nových používateľov alebo položky, a problém “riedkosti”, ktorý bráni presnosti z dôvodu nedostatočných údajov – najmä v prípade špecializovaných alebo menej populárnych položiek.
Záver
Na záver možno konštatovať, že kolaboratívne filtrovanie sa ukazuje ako silný systém odporúčaní, ktorý vytvára návrhy šité na mieru a využíva pri tom kolektívne preferencie a správanie používateľov. Prispôsobuje odporúčania prostredníctvom metodík zameraných na používateľa a položku bez toho, aby vyžadoval podrobné informácie o položke alebo používateľovi, a to napriek pretrvávajúcim problémom, ako je dilema “studeného štartu” a nedostatok údajov; pokrok v strojovom učení a analýze údajov sľubuje ďalšie zdokonalenie, ktoré v budúcnosti zabezpečí čoraz presnejšie a relevantnejšie odporúčania.